What to Wear on a Royal Caribbean Cruise: Explained
When it comes to what to wear on a royal Caribbean cruise, it's important to consider the dress code and the specific activities and events you'll be participating in. During the day, casual attire such as shorts, t-shirts, and sundresses are appropriate. It's also a good idea to pack swimwear and cover-ups for poolside lounging or water activities.
In the evening, there are typically two dress codes to consider: casual and formal. Casual attire can range from jeans and a nice top to a casual dress or skirt. It's important to note that tank tops, swimwear, and flip-flops are usually not allowed in the main dining rooms or specialty restaurants during dinner hours.
On formal nights, the dress code is more upscale. Women typically wear cocktail dresses or evening gowns, while men opt for suits or tuxedos. It's a great opportunity to dress up and enjoy a glamorous evening on the cruise.
It's also important to pack appropriate footwear for the various activities on the cruise. Comfortable walking shoes are essential for shore excursions and exploring the ports of call. Sandals or flip-flops are great for poolside lounging, and a pair of dress shoes or heels are necessary for formal evenings.
Don't forget to pack accessories to complete your outfits, such as hats, sunglasses, and jewelry. It's also a good idea to bring a light jacket or sweater for cooler evenings or air-conditioned areas on the ship.
